Notice for the facilities desk, Copperhale Plaza: both passenger lifts will undergo scheduled maintenance this Saturday and Sunday, 07:00–17:00. Visitors during this window must be directed to the north stairwell, and anyone with mobility needs should be booked onto the goods lift, which remains operational with an escort. Please log every escorted trip in the weekend register. The goods lift and the stairwell fire doors are keypad-controlled; staff should use the code below.

badge for fafop-fajof: bdg-Z-47

Projected annual savings are 14% against current staffing costs, with a one-time transition expense amortised over two years. Break-even is expected in month nineteen. Risks include handover attrition and a projected temporary dip in satisfaction scores, which could affect renewal conversations your teams are leading. Sales leads should factor this into account planning for the next two quarters. Please note the following before client discussions.

board note of kagep-yahig: Only 9 of the 120 pilot accounts renewed Quenix, so a churn review is set for April 1.

## Environment Variables — ORM Migration Shim

During the Tallowfield ORM refactor, the legacy `oldmapper` layer and the new `quarry` layer run side by side, gated by `QUARRY_DUAL_WRITE=true`. Reviewers should confirm that dual-write mode never logs row contents and that `QUARRY_STRICT_SCHEMA=1` is set in all non-dev tiers. The shim verifies row checksums against the legacy store, which requires the comparison service credential to be present in the env file as the very next line.

sealed setting: RELAY_SECRET5=82864

Ticket VX-1142 — spoolerd microservice (Harkett Print Platform). The job-intake endpoint accepts unsigned payloads when the upstream gateway header is missing, bypassing the signature check entirely. No exploitation observed. Fix enforces signature validation regardless of headers and rejects with 403. Security review requested on the fallback path. The patched build reference appears below.

build token for haduf-bafog: htk21_2d98ce91a83676b65394a